1. The Hidden Impact of a Poor Mattress on Your Health

a. Back and Neck Pain

Back and neck pain is one of the first issues people living with an old or low-quality mattress experience. Lack of support from the mattress leads to misalignment of the spine, causing pain in the lower back, neck, and shoulders. When the mattress sags, you sink too far and take awkward sleeping positions, which over the years leads to musculoskeletal pain that can demoralize you and affect your mobility.

Tip: if you feel sore and stiff in the morning and feel better after moving around, it is likely your mattress and not your body that is to blame.

c. Allergies and Respiratory Problems

Old mattresses collect dust mites, mold, and other allergens. Even regular mattess cleaning cannot remove years of built up dust which consists of sweat, skin particles, and moisture. This can cause nasal blockages, skin irritations, or exacerbate asthma and other symptoms for people with allergies.

Allergies can lead to sneezing or other asthma symptoms. These is a reason people in Saskatoon are upgrading to hypoallergenic mattresses. These mattresses have modern moisture shields which justify the modern investment people make with hypoallergenic mattresses.


d. Joint Pain and Pressure Points

If your mattress is too firm or too soft, it can fail to distribute body weight evenly. This creates pressure points, especially around your hips, shoulders, and knees. Over time, this not only disturbs your sleep but can also worsen conditions like arthritis or joint stiffness.

Modern mattresses, especially those in the queen size mattress category, often include zoned support layers designed to relieve pressure while keeping your spine aligned — an investment that pays off in comfort and health.

2. Signs It’s Time to Replace Your Mattress

It’s easy to get used to a mattress, even when it’s no longer doing its job. Here are key indicators that your current bed might be doing more harm than good:

  • You wake up tired or sore despite getting a full night’s sleep.

  • You can feel lumps, springs, or sagging spots.

  • Your allergies are acting up more often than usual.

  • You sleep better in hotels or on other beds.

  • Your mattress is over 7–10 years old.

4. Choosing the Right Mattress for Your Needs

When it’s time to replace your mattress, here are some key factors to consider:

a. Mattress Type

  • Memory Foam: Ideal for pressure relief and contouring comfort.

  • Hybrid: Combines foam and innerspring coils for support and breathability.

  • Latex: Naturally cooling and hypoallergenic with a responsive feel.

  • Innerspring: Offers traditional bounce with strong edge support.

b. Size and Sleeping Arrangement

The queen size mattress remains one of the most popular options — offering a perfect balance between space and versatility. It’s ideal for couples, single sleepers who prefer extra room, or guest bedrooms.

If you have more space or share your bed with pets or children, you might even consider a king-size mattress for additional comfort.


c. Firmness and Support

The level of comfort will depend on each individual's personal preference. Softer mattresses that alleviate the pressure of the hips and shoulders are usually preferred by side sleepers. Back and stomach sleepers benefit from firmer mattresses that help keep the spine aligned.
